Trying to determine what is going on in the mind of a 14 year old is not the easiest thing to do. Normally when a girl has dreams of a guy, especially when she is the guy, the dream is addressing masculine aspects {animus} of the dreamer. We all have masculine as well as feminine aspects. For a girl her animus is her inner masculine and would be a set of unconscious masculine attributes and potentials. Examples of these potentials are The animus can endow a woman with assertiveness, courage, strength, vitality, decisiveness, a focused attentiveness, and a desire for achievement.
